Super Eagles star Ademola Lookman has officially handed in a transfer request to Serie A side Atalanta, expressing his desire to join Inter Milan.
According to renowned football transfer journalist Fabrizio Romano, Lookman’s decision comes after Atalanta reportedly rejected several offers from Inter.
“EXCL: Ademola Lookman has now handed in a transfer request,” Romano revealed via X on Sunday.
“The Nigerian forward has officially asked Atalanta to leave the club after Italian side rejected Inter opening bid. Lookman wants to join Inter.”
Sources close to the player say the player is furious with Atalanta’s refusal to sanction the move and is now pushing to force the transfer through.
The 26-year-old forward, who played a pivotal role in Atalanta’s UEFA Europa League triumph, is reportedly eager to take the next step in his career at a club competing regularly for domestic titles and Champions League glory.
Negotiations are expected to intensify in the coming days as Inter weigh their next move.
